Carl graduated from Glasgow University with an MSC in Applied Mathematics. As a part-qualified CIMA accountant he has gained experience across four sectors where his focus has been to build effective accounting systems and processes, financial management and support senior management in making business decisions.
 
Carl was the third AfID volunteer working with Cambodian Rural Development Team (CRDT) in rural Kratié Province; supporting them for 3 months from June to Sept 2015. In addition to mentoring the Finance Manager he worked on their microfinance project, created a funding pipeline tool, and helped improve communication between finance and non-finance staff.
